The quality of a discussion often depends on how closely the parties attend to the same issue. For the passage below, determine whether the speakers are clearly disputing the same issue, or whether somebody is missing the point.
A: I can't believe the student government paid John Kerry over a thousand dollars to come here and give a speech. He's been out of the news for ages, and he's clearly biased. They should have saved our money.
B: Listen, George Bush Sr. has been out of office for a while now too, and he's clearly as biased as anybody. Nevertheless, people pay tons of money for him to come and speak. So lay off about Kerry.

Herfindahl Index

A measure of the size of firms in relation to the industry and an indicator of the amount of competition among them, calculated by squaring the market share of each firm within the industry and then summing the total.

Vertical Merger

A merger between two companies that operate at different stages of the production process for a specific product.
